two.2.4) Description of the procurement

The ACRO Criminal Records Office is seeking suitable providers to take a holistic view of ACRO’s database solutions and make suggestions for how to replace and improve outdated areas of our technology. We’re looking to engage with providers to understand the solutions which best suit our business needs and strategic aims. We are seeking responses by 29/04/22 and we intend to invite providers for presentations and Q&A sessions in the week commencing 09/05/22.

We anticipate running an open procurement process following this engagement, depending on the responses received from this PIN. We will provide a statement of requirements at that stage.

The chosen provider may be required to work with an existing supplier during a transition period.
